RIFLE SHOOTING.

A CAMBRIDGE MATCH. CAMBRIDGE, Monday The Waikato Mounted Rifles No. 3 Company fired a handicap match on Saturday for Mr Thomas’ medals. The weather was exceedingly bad. The Ranfuriy Rifles held n shouting match between teams headed by Captain Smith and Lleat. Garry, the result being a win for the former by 19 points. The vcmHut was very unfavourable. Capt. Smith’s team scored 556 points. Stockey 86 and Corporal Tronson 81, being the highest scorers; while Lieut. Garry’s team registered 537. Corporal Stephens 82 and JPrivate Walsh 70, occupying the leading positions. PALMERSTON GUARDS BEAT SHANNON R.C. PALMERSTON N.. Monday. A rifle match between teams representing the Shannon Rifle Club and the Palmerston North Guards was won by the latter by three points. The weather was very bad, rain fulling nearly all the time, and consequently only seven shots al 200 yards and five nt 300 yards were tired. Palmerston North registered 281 points, ami Shannon 278. Lance-Corporal Vincent (45) nnd Lieut. Murray (48) were the highest acorera for the winners; Riflemen Sherman, Hallam. and Curren (46 each) filling the corresponding positions for the losers.
